Measurement of Quality of Life and Perceived Disease Impact on Quality of Life in Asthma

Description

Existing disease-specific quality of life (QoL) scales do not directly assess QoL or the perceived impact of the disease on QoL. The purpose of this study is to evaluate the properties (reliability, concurrent and longitudinal validity, and responsiveness to change in asthma status) of a new measure of the patient-perceived negative effects of asthma in adults, the Asthma Impact on Quality of Life Scale (A-IQOLS), and to compare its properties with those of a measure of current QoL, the Flanagan Quality of Life Scale (QOLS). The hypothesis is that the approach represented by the A-IQOLS will prove superior to that of the QOLS as an outcome measure for clinical research purposes. This research can fill a significant gap in the currently available tools, with consequent benefit to clinical research and measurement of patient-centered outcomes in other disease areas.

PI is Sandra Wilson, PhD. PAMF Co-Investigators: 
Michael Mulligan; MD, Alan Chausow, MD; Estela Ayala, MD. Outside Co-Investigators:  Robert Wise, MD, Johns Hopkins University Schools of Medicine and Public Health; Mario Castro, MD, Washington University School of Medicine. 

Principal Investigator

Sandra Wilson, Ph.D.

Funder

National Heart, Lung and Blood Institute/National Institutes of Health

Start Date

April 01, 2014

End Date

March 31, 2017

Related Studies

Advance Care Planning in Older Adults With Multiple Medical Conditions Undergoing High-Risk Surgery

Goal is to determine the prevalence of preop documentation of ACP among older, high-risk surgical pts with multiple conditions.

Investigators: Ellis C. Dillon, Ph.D., External PI, Principal Investigator 

Evaluation of a Lifestyle Intervention Adopted for Clinical Practice for Diabetes Prevention (ELEVATE-DP)

This study will identify important barriers to and facilitators of translating an efficacious diabetes prevention intervention (Group Lifestyle Balance, GLB)

Investigators: Kristen M.J. Azar, R.N., BSN, MSN/MPH, Sylvia Sudat, PhD, Robert Romanelli, Ph.D., MPH, Alice R. Pressman, Ph.D., M.S. 

Implementing Universal Lynch Syndrome Screening Across Multiple Healthcare Systems: Identifying Strategies to Facilitate and Maintain Programs in Different Organizations Contexts

To describe and explain variations in Lynch syndrome (LS) screening implementation across healthcare systems and create a toolkit for implementing LS screening.

Investigators: External PI, Principal Investigator, Su-Ying Liang, Ph.D., Monique de Bruin, M.D., MPH 

Improving Cancer Care

Project will provide information about referrals to palliative care and way to enhance goals of care discussions for patients diagnosed with stage IV cancer.

Investigators: Harold (Hal) Luft, Ph.D., Su-Ying Liang, Ph.D., Ellis C. Dillon, Ph.D. 

Improving the Outcomes of Older Adults with Psychosocial Vulnerability Undergoing Major Surgery.

Dr. Dillon will lead the qualitative research--data collection and analysis.

Investigators: Ellis C. Dillon, Ph.D., External PI, Principal Investigator 

Multilevel Study of Lung Cancer Screening Guidelines Implementation (MUST)

Provide insights into preventive services for lung cancer. This research will contribute to the concurrent progress in lung cancer screening with LDCT.

Investigators: Jiang Li, Ph.D., MPH, Dorothy Hung, Ph.D., M.A., MPH 

Open and Ask Study

Study is a head-to-head comparison of three different interventions that empower patients to speak up and enable MDs to respond effectively when they do.

Investigators: Albert S. Chan, M.D., M.S., FAAFP, Cheryl Stults, Ph.D., Dominick L. Frosch, Ph.D. 

Pilot Project in Applied Artificial Intelligence: Using Machine Learning to Improve the Safety of Hospital Care

Develop and test predictive model identifying emerging sepsis using artificial intelligence, and translate learnings into improved operational criteria.

Investigators: Alice R. Pressman, Ph.D., M.S., Sylvia Sudat, PhD 

Severe Mental Illness and Patterns of Emergency Department Utilization

Purpose is to provide descriptive info for improving health outcomes by identifying a subgroup of high-frequency ER patients who may have severe mental illness.

Investigators: Kristen M.J. Azar, R.N., BSN, MSN/MPH, Alice R. Pressman, Ph.D., M.S. 

Stupski Serious Illness Program Evaluation

Evaluate palliative care projects at seven healthcare organizations in the SF Bay Area.

Investigators: Ellis C. Dillon, Ph.D., Sylvia Sudat, PhD
